RCMP looking into racist graffiti on West Hants social service building

RCMP are looking into a case of hate speech being carved into a door in West Hants.

Police say they got a call about the graffiti on Friday but believe it happened some time between Wednesday and Friday at a social services agency on Foundry Road.

The suspect allegedly scratched racist graffiti into the door but municipal staff quickly painted over it.

If anyone has information related to the incident, police ask you to call the West Hants RCMP at 902-798-2207.

The investigation continues.
